The hair cycle normally consists of growing, resting and falling hairs and there is a delicate balance between these stages of hair cycle. Normally hair should regrow but if its not happening, you should consider seeing a dematologist. The treatment typically consists of usage of oral medication (Finasteride) and topical lotion (Minoxidil ). The dosage and duration is decided by your dermatologist. You need to be patient with the treatment protocol as it takes months to see initial improvement. Certain dermatologists supplement biotin, hair serum and advice procedures like PRP therapy which may accelerate the rate of hair growth. PRP needs multiple sessions roughly at 6 weeks intervals.
